What Factors Affect the Stability and Shelf Life of Formulated Milk?

Temperature:

  1. Temperature plays a critical role in the stability of formulated milk. Higher temperatures can accelerate the growth of microorganisms and lead to spoilage. It is essential to store formulated milk in a cool, dry place, away from direct sunlight and heat sources. Maintaining the recommended storage temperature specified on the product packaging helps preserve its nutritional content and extends its shelf life.

Humidity:

  1. Excessive humidity can contribute to the degradation of formulated milk, leading to clumping and microbial growth. To ensure optimal stability and prevent spoilage, it is crucial to store the product in a dry environment. Consider using airtight containers or resealable packaging to maintain low humidity levels and protect the milk powder from moisture.

Oxygen Exposure:

  1. Oxygen exposure can cause oxidation of the fats and other components present in formulated milk. This can result in a rancid smell and taste. To minimize oxygen exposure, it is recommended to tightly seal the container after each use and store the milk powder away from sources of oxygen, such as open containers or high-traffic areas.

How to Enhance the Shelf Life of Formulated Milk?

Proper Handling and Storage:

  1. Follow the manufacturer’s instructions for storing and handling formulated milk. Ensure that the packaging remains intact and undamaged before purchasing. Store the product in a clean, cool, and dry place, away from strong odors or chemicals, which can affect its quality.

Hygienic Preparation:

  1. Maintain proper hygiene during the preparation of formulated milk. Wash your hands thoroughly before handling the product, sterilize feeding utensils, and use clean, boiled water to mix the formula. Prepared milk should be consumed within the recommended time frame, usually within two hours, to prevent bacterial growth.

Regular Inspection:

  1. Regularly inspect the formulated milk for any signs of spoilage, such as an off smell, unusual color, or clumps. If you notice any abnormalities, discard the product immediately, as consuming spoiled milk can pose health risks to infants.
